The Biewer Yorkshire Axel terrier welpen kaufen is the first breed of its kind to be born in Germany in 1984, resulting from two traditional colored Yorkies with an recessive gene called the Piebald. This gene gives the dog a tri-colored banded or belted look. Due to their distinctive coloration, Biewer Yorkies are recognized as a distinct breed in Germany by the Allgemeiner Club der Hundefreunde Deutschland e. V (ACH).

The Biewer Yorkshire Terrier is a relatively new breed, and is not recognized by the American Kennel Club (AKC). However it is a recognized member of the American Rare Breed Association (ARBA) and has its own breed club in the United States, the Biewer Yorkie Club of America.
Biewers were born as a result of the rare presence of a recessive gene in two Yorkshire Terriers. The pied puppy enthralled its German breeders Werner and Gertrud, who started a breeding programme to produce more of these puppies. The results were successful, and the Biewer Terrier was born.
A Biewer Terrier is akin to the Yorkshire Terrier in appearance, however, the Biewer has a more tri-colored coat, and does not have a docked tail. It is also less terrier-like and more patient than the traditional Yorkie. This makes the Biewer Terrier an excellent option for families with young children or other pets.
